Floor Lamp Sculptural Murano Glass Ettore Fantasia Gino Poli for Sothis 1970s

About the Item

Rare and impressive "Excalibur" floor lamp produced in Italy between the end of the sixties and the beginning of the seventies, by the designers Ettore Fantasia and Gino Poli for Sothis Murano. The lamp was made with 7 rods of different sizes that create a "vortex" effect in blown and intertwined Murano glass, transparent and white, which screw into a circular base in chromed metal.
